Dáil Éireann debate -
Wednesday, 29 Nov 1922

Vol. 1 No. 32

CEISTEANNA—QUESTIONS. - PRINTING TRADE IN CORK.

To ask the Minister for Finance if he is aware of the large amount of unemployment existing in the printing trade in Cork, and if he is prepared to allocate a share of Government printing to that city.

There are running contracts for most of the printing required for the Stationery Office. Special tenders are invited from a large number of firms, including those in Cork, for work not provided for in these contracts. During the past few months difficulty has been experienced, owing to impaired communication, in asking firms in Cork to quote. Two large Cork firms hold contracts for the printing of the Electors Lists and Registers for the County and Borough of Cork. I understand that there is much unemployment in the printing trade throughout southern Ireland generally. Every opportunity will be given to printing firms in Cork to tender.
